What is a Self-Emptying Robot Vacuum?
A self-emptying robot vacuum What Is Self Emptying Robot Vacuum a smart device developed to manage the arduous job of cleaning floor surface areas while likewise autonomously disposing of gathered dust, dirt, and particles. Unlike standard robot vacuums that need frequent manual emptying, self-emptying designs feature a base station that collects the waste from the vacuum, permitting it to recharge and continue cleaning without constant human intervention.

While self-emptying robot vacuums can be a significant investment, they are not without their drawbacks. Here are some considerations potential purchasers need to bear in mind:
Initial Cost: These sophisticated designs often include a greater price compared to standard robot vacuums.
Upkeep: While they are low-maintenance, users still require to clean the base station from time to time to ensure ideal efficiency.
Sound Level: Some designs might produce sound during operation or emptying cycles, which might be disruptive in peaceful environments.
Size and Design: The base station uses up space, so buyers require to ensure there is adequate room for it.
Pet Compatibility: While numerous models are designed with animal owners in mind, not all are similarly reliable at dealing with pet hair and bigger debris.
